To meet CMS requirements for the submission of risk adjustment data and ensure they are being fully reimbursed by CMS, payer organizations need increasingly specific coding information, and these requests for information can put undo administrative burdens on provider organizations. Seeking to increase the payer organization’s access to needed information without increasing the provider organization’s workload, the collaborators in this case study established an API that enables an automated, standardized retrieval process for records that the payer organization needs in order to complete managed care audits.
